ABOUT THE DESIGNER

Max Frisch is an artist and designer, from Kansas City, MO and founder of YINDIVISION.

YINDIVISION is the hub for all of Max’s creative work with a focus on fashion. He also has a deep interest in illustration, photography/videography.

At 26 years old, Max has spent the last 8 years trying out different art forms and following his interest wherever it leads. At some point along the way, he discovered Eastern philosophy which became a huge inspirstion for his artwork going forward. Eventually, this lead to YINDIVISION.

YIN is the dark side of yin-yang which is often associated with qualities such as introspection, emtpiness, calmness, depth, decay. A lotus flower roots in mud and darkness, (yin qualities), before growing into a bright flower, that sits above the water in the sunlight (yang qualities). The lotus flower is a perfect representation of how people view Yin, it is often overlooked and under appreciated, yet vital and equally important.

Max’s mission is to give light to what is often overlooked and to show the beauty/importance of these often hidden qualities through fashion and visual art.
